Sleeper Agent Meaning
A sleeper agent is someone who remains inactive or unnoticed for a long period before suddenly becoming active to complete a hidden purpose or reveal an unexpected ability.
Quick Definition
- Originally: A secret intelligence operative who blends into society until activated for a mission.
- Modern slang: A person who unexpectedly shows hidden skills, surprising behavior, or sudden loyalty.
- Online usage: Someone who appears ordinary but later shocks everyone.

Origin and Background
The phrase sleeper agent comes from the world of intelligence and espionage.
During the twentieth century, intelligence agencies around the world reportedly trained agents to live ordinary lives in foreign countries. These individuals blended into society, built careers, raised families, and avoided drawing attention. They remained “asleep,” meaning inactive, until they received instructions to carry out a mission.

As internet culture grew, people borrowed the phrase and began using it metaphorically.
Instead of referring to actual spies, it became a funny way of describing someone who unexpectedly reveals hidden talent or surprising behavior.

Comparison Table
| Term | Meaning | Typical Use |
|---|---|---|
| Sleeper Agent | Hidden until unexpectedly active | Secret talents or spy references |
| Dark Horse | Unexpected winner | Sports, competitions |
| Hidden Gem | Something valuable but unnoticed | Movies, restaurants, people |
| Double Agent | Works for two opposing sides | Espionage |
| Secret Weapon | Unexpected advantage | Teams, business, sports |
| Open Book | Easy to understand | Personality |
| Wild Card | Unpredictable person | Competitions and life |
Key Insight
A sleeper agent usually stays unnoticed for a long time before revealing something significant, while terms like dark horse and hidden gem focus more on unexpected success rather than hidden identity.
